Chemical Profile and Mechanism of Action
Acetyl Heptapeptide-4, with the sequence Ac-Glu-Glu-Met-Gln-Arg-Arg-Ala, is a carefully synthesized peptide chain. Its primary mechanism involves modulating the neuromuscular signals that cause facial muscle contractions, thereby reducing the depth and appearance of wrinkles. This action is often compared to topical retinoids or neuro-cosmetic agents, but Acetyl Heptapeptide-4 offers a distinct profile focused on signal modulation rather than cellular turnover or retinoid-like irritation. Furthermore, Acetyl Heptapeptide-4 is recognized for its role in promoting skin barrier health by supporting a balanced skin microbiome. It functions as a prebiotic, enhancing the proliferation of beneficial skin bacteria while inhibiting pathogenic ones. This action contributes to a stronger, more resilient skin barrier, reducing transepidermal water loss (TEWL) and mitigating sensitivity and inflammation. Formulation Considerations and Stability
Incorporating Acetyl Heptapeptide-4 into formulations requires attention to pH, temperature, and compatibility with other ingredients. Typically, it is stable in aqueous solutions within a physiological pH range and is compatible with many common cosmetic actives. Its water solubility makes it easy to incorporate into serums, emulsions, and gels.
